Wehner Logistics holds a Tabular Transaction Dataset from its e-commerce fulfillment services, available via API. This granular `transaction_data` captures customer purchase histories, product interactions, and logistics details, providing a rich source for building and fine-tuning predictive Recommendation Models to enhance customer personalization and forecast buying behavior.
The business value is anchored in the global Recommendation Engine Market, which was valued at USD 3.92 billion in 2023 and is projected to expand at a CAGR of 36.3%. [2] Despite access complexities like its position within the Noerpel Gruppe, high GDPR sensitivity due to customer PII, and potential shared data ownership with clients, the rarity and direct utility of this fulfillment data for a high-growth AI use-case present a significant strategic opportunity. [2] ⚠ Diligence (valuable data, access to negotiate): Subsidiary of Noerpel Gruppe; data strategy likely coordinated at group level.; High GDPR sensitivity due to e-commerce customer PII (names, addresses).; Data ownership may be shared with e-commerce clients depending on fulfillment contracts. · corporate: subsidiary of Noerpel Gruppe.
